Transaction 3871a7930af053e70da37f432648ab93705f7031c3865e00779e61400ad490a0

1 Input
2 Outputs
  • 3871a7930af053e70da37f432648ab93705f7031c3865e00779e61400ad490a0:0
  • value  510000
    address  34DpSi3bpGPyLuGfBMNtk1mY6iQaN6Zq2Z
  • 3871a7930af053e70da37f432648ab93705f7031c3865e00779e61400ad490a0:1
  • value  10702996
    address  17FduMYv6g9rRLEYQqwuSBTGMyLZM7HStc